Closed Bug 1861204 Opened 1 year ago Closed 8 months ago

Tooltip title missing from subject line on Table View

Categories

(Thunderbird :: Disability Access, defect, P1)

Thunderbird 115

Tracking

(Accessibility Severity:s2, thunderbird_esr115 wontfix)

RESOLVED FIXED
125 Branch
Accessibility Severity s2
Tracking Status
thunderbird_esr115 --- wontfix

People

(Reporter: aleca, Assigned: welpy-cw)

References

(Blocks 1 open bug, Regression)

Details

(Keywords: access, regression)

Attachments

(2 files)

Hovering over the subject column doesn't show the tooltip anymore.
The tooltip appears only after the message row has been selected.
This issue is caused by the data-l10n-id attributes on the table cells.

Severity: -- → S3
Accessibility Severity: --- → s2
Keywords: access
Priority: -- → P1
Assignee: nobody → elizabeth
Status: NEW → ASSIGNED
See Also: → 1856495

The title attribute appears to be being overwritten for some reason, maybe due to how data-l10n-id works. The title is added in about3Pane.js but at some point is removed. I'm looking into this.

Seems like this is happening because the titles get removed when you swap between table and card view.. just on the table view though.

(In reply to Vineet Deo from comment #2)

Seems like this is happening because the titles get removed when you swap between table and card view.. just on the table view though.

This is helpful. Thank you!

Also, according to Martin, when things are selected and unselected, the tooltip can also disappear, which is unexpected.

Attachment #9363394 - Attachment description: WIP: Bug 1861204 - Add title tooltip in Table View. → WIP: Bug 1861204 - Ensure title tooltip for subject displays in Table View.
Blocks: 1854787
Regressed by: 1854787
Attachment #9363394 - Attachment description: WIP: Bug 1861204 - Ensure title tooltip for subject displays in Table View. → WIP: Bug 1861204 - Ensure title tooltip for subject displays in Table
Attachment #9363394 - Attachment description: WIP: Bug 1861204 - Ensure title tooltip for subject displays in Table → WIP: Bug 1861204 - Ensure title tooltip for subject displays in Table View.
Attachment #9363394 - Attachment description: WIP: Bug 1861204 - Ensure title tooltip for subject displays in Table View. → Bug 1861204 - Ensure title tooltip for subject displays in Table View. r=#thunderbird-front-end-reviewers
Blocks: 1867685
Attachment #9363394 - Attachment description: Bug 1861204 - Ensure title tooltip for subject displays in Table View. r=#thunderbird-front-end-reviewers → WIP: Bug 1861204 - Ensure title tooltip for subject displays in Table View. r=#thunderbird-front-end-reviewers
See Also: → 1860562
Attachment #9363394 - Attachment description: WIP: Bug 1861204 - Ensure title tooltip for subject displays in Table View. r=#thunderbird-front-end-reviewers → Bug 1861204 - Ensure title tooltip for subject displays in Table View. r=#thunderbird-front-end-reviewers
Attachment #9363394 - Attachment description: Bug 1861204 - Ensure title tooltip for subject displays in Table View. r=#thunderbird-front-end-reviewers → WIP: Bug 1861204 - Ensure tooltip for subject displays in Table View. r=#thunderbird-front-end-reviewers
See Also: → 522768
Duplicate of this bug: 1872894
Attachment #9363394 - Attachment description: WIP: Bug 1861204 - Ensure tooltip for subject displays in Table View. r=#thunderbird-front-end-reviewers → Bug 1861204 - Ensure tooltip for subject displays in Table View. r=#thunderbird-front-end-reviewers
Duplicate of this bug: 1867685
Duplicate of this bug: 1877050

Adding myself to CC and noting that I see this on 123.0b2 Ubuntu. It's very hit and miss as too when the tooltip works on a new or old email.

My issue as above is with the standard message list not the table view. Do I need to open a different bug?

Attachment #9363394 - Attachment description: Bug 1861204 - Ensure tooltip for subject displays in Table View. r=#thunderbird-front-end-reviewers → WIP: Bug 1861204 - Ensure tooltip for subject displays in Table View. r=#thunderbird-front-end-reviewers
See Also: → 1876416
Attachment #9363394 - Attachment description: WIP: Bug 1861204 - Ensure tooltip for subject displays in Table View. r=#thunderbird-front-end-reviewers → WIP: Bug 1861204 - Ensure tooltip for subject displays in Table View. r=aleca
Attachment #9363394 - Attachment description: WIP: Bug 1861204 - Ensure tooltip for subject displays in Table View. r=aleca → Bug 1861204 - Ensure tooltip for subject displays in Table View. r=aleca
Assignee: elijmitchell → h.w.forms

Pushed by daniel@thunderbird.net:
https://hg.mozilla.org/comm-central/rev/2f81da701a84
Ensure tooltip for subject displays in Table View. r=aleca,dandarnell

Status: ASSIGNED → RESOLVED
Closed: 9 months ago
Resolution: --- → FIXED

Causing bug 1884498 - will back out.

Status: RESOLVED → REOPENED
Flags: needinfo?(h.w.forms)
Resolution: FIXED → ---
Target Milestone: --- → 125 Branch

Why on earth did I forget to push this to Try? Anyway, this seems to fix the failing test, but I don't know if this is the right way to go. Could you please have a look, John?

Flags: needinfo?(h.w.forms) → needinfo?(john)
Regressions: 1884498
Flags: needinfo?(john)

Pushed by daniel@thunderbird.net:
https://hg.mozilla.org/comm-central/rev/802fa7ad4000
Ensure tooltip for subject displays in Table View. r=aleca,dandarnell
https://hg.mozilla.org/comm-central/rev/183d1b252fe7
Follow-up: disable l10n for custom columns. r=john.bieling

Status: REOPENED → RESOLVED
Closed: 9 months ago8 months ago
Resolution: --- → FIXED
Duplicate of this bug: 1892375
Duplicate of this bug: 1899046
Version: Trunk → Thunderbird 115
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: